‘Air strike kills 40’ at Libya migrant centre
Live news, business and sport from around the world.
At least 40 people have been killed by an air strike that hit a migrant detention centre in Libya, officials say. Another 80 are reported to have been wounded in the explosion, which happened at a facility in the eastern Tajoura suburb of the capital, Tripoli.
In Sudan, the Ethiopian mediators are calling for the transitional military council and representatives of the protesters to resume talks.
The UN World Food Programme says it's more than doubling its aid to the east of the Democratic Republic of Congo, where more than 300,000 people have been displaced by recent fighting.
